TV5 denies Sharon will receive a P16-M salary


Ngayon, puwede nang sabihin na kaya lumipat si Gabby Concepcion sa TV5 ay dahil kay Vic Del Rosario of Viva Films, who is now co-managing  him.

Naengganyo si Gabby sa magagandang projects na ini-offer sa kanya ng Kapatid Network, tulad ng PS I Love You, mapapanood na sa Lunes (Nov. 21), pagkatapos ng Glamorosa. Gusto ni ni Gabby gumawa ng  makakabuluhang projects worthy for his comeback.

Kaya nga inayawan niya noon ang movie na inialok sa kanya ng GMA Films na light comedy na mala-Love Boat ang tema, kasi para sa kanya that’s not a good comeback vehicle for him.

Ngayon nga, masaya na siya bilang bagong Kapatid at nakasama pa niya ang first leading lady niya ever na si Dina Bonnevie (Katorse  was their first movie). Aminado ang TV5 na hindi nila in-offer kay Sharon Cuneta ang PS I Love You , kasi alam nila na hindi gumagawa ng soapsi Sharon at nakatali pa ang Megastar sa ABS-CBN. But rumors are persistent, by next year, magiging Kapatid na rin si Sharon, so, may possibility na magkasama na rin sina Shawie at Gabo sa isang project under TV5 na hindi nagawa ng Kapamilya.

“TV5 is very much inte-rested in securing the services of Ms. Sharon Cuneta. But as of now, naka-depende ‘yun kay Vic Del Rosario ng Viva who is handling the negotiations. At saka hindi sa amin nakadepende kung matutuloy ang Sharon-Gabby project which  we really love to make. Nakadepende ýun kay Sharon lahat,”pahayag ni Mr. Perci Intalan, VP for Entertainment ng TV5.

Pero dinenay ni Perci ang tsikang may offer ang TV5 kay Sharon na P16-M monthly guaranteed salary. Maski ang controversial na P700,000 per taping na offer daw ng TV5 kay John Lloyd Cruz, ‘di raw niya puwedeng sabihin.

“May offer talaga ang TV5 kay John Lloyd, but I’m not at liberty to disclose the exact amount. Pero sa isyung ginamit lang ni John Lloyd ang TV5 para magpataas ng presyo sa ABS-CBN, I cannot comment on that kasi wala akong alam d’yan. We are not forcing naman anyone to be a Kapatid. Basta we would like to work with stars who would like to work with us,”say pa ni Mr. Perci.

Hindi rin siya makapag-comment nang diretso tungkol sa balitang paglipat ng Star For All Seasons na si Gov. Vilma Santos sa TV5.

“All I can say, gustung-gusto ng TV5 na makatrabaho si Gov. Vi. Naghahanap pa kami ng magandang project para sa kanya kasi ýun ang ibinigay na kundis-yon sa amin ni Vi. Dapat maganda ang project. I don’t think makakagawa ng soap si Vi dahil super-busy siya sa work niya as Batangas governor. We are even willing to hold the tapings sa Batangas mismo para hindi na siya aalis pa du’n, pero mukhang hindi pa rin uubra,” kuwento pa ni Perci.

Regarding PS I Love You, gustong ipaalam ng TV5 sa lahat na hindi ito re-make kundi sequel sa movie nina Sharon at Gabby na ipinalabas noong 1981. Isasalaysay dito ang naging buhay nina Mark (Gabby) at Kristine (gagampanan ni Dina B.) 30 years later .
